## Read-Replica Lag Alarm

New folks: the ReplicaLagHigh alarm covers the Ostrel reporting replicas. It fires when lag exceeds 90 seconds for five minutes. Most triggers come from the nightly Bramwell export job, which is expected and auto-resolves. Do not fail over the replica yourself — that requires the data-platform lead's approval and a change ticket. If the alarm persists past 20 minutes with no export running, write to the platform inbox.

billing contact of yahip-yadup = eliax.druix@zemvarworks.corp

## Deployment

Lattermoor Relay supports per-message websocket compression. Tradeoff: compression cuts bandwidth roughly 60% on chatty clients but raises CPU on the edge nodes and adds memory per connection for the sliding window. We disable it for connections under 1 KB average frame size and enable it elsewhere. New team members: do not toggle this per-environment without load testing first. The defaults we deploy with in all regions are as follows.

deployment values, faduf-tawep:
SORDOR_LOG_LEVEL=error
SORDOR_METRICS_HOST=metrics.sordor.nelvrolabs.internal
SORDOR_POOL_SIZE=4

Subject: DR Drill — Cold Start Expectations for Wrenfold Handlers

Team, during Thursday's disaster-recovery drill we will fail over the Wrenfold serverless handlers to the standby region. Expect cold starts of up to eight seconds on first invocations; please tell callers this is anticipated, not an outage. To access the drill dashboard, use the recovery passphrase listed below.

recovery phrase for kajop-yagef: istael-ulaius